121002021131 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 121002021132. Its totient is φ = 121002021130.

The previous prime is 121002021079. The next prime is 121002021139. The reversal of 121002021131 is 131120200121.

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-121002021131 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×1210020211312 (a number of 23 digits) contains 22 as substring.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(121002021139)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 60501010565 + 60501010566.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(60501010566).

Almost surely, 2121002021131 is an apocalyptic number.

121002021131 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

121002021131 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

121002021131 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 24, while the sum is 14.

Adding to 121002021131 its reverse (131120200121), we get a palindrome (252122221252).

The spelling of 121002021131 in words is "one hundred twenty-one billion, two million, twenty-one thousand, one hundred thirty-one".
